Virtual Phantoms Inc. announced the release of VirtualDoseIR, a tool for assessing organ dose from interventional radiology (IR) procedures. Like its VirtualDose CT product for computed tomography, VirtualDoseIR combines a family of anatomically realistic human phantoms, advanced Monte Carlo simulations, and an easy-to-use web interface to provide realistic calculations of dose to a diverse patient population.

In petri dishes in her campus laboratory at New Jersey Institute of Technology, Alice Lee is developing colonies of cardiac cells, formed into chambers, that pump and contract like a human heart. Derived from stem cells, these primitive organs will help her achieve a research milestone: to observe in microscopic, real-time detail how the heart repairs itself after injury.
